XRP钱包开发:如何打造安全又易用的数字钱包?

              发布时间:2025-10-03 17:39:14

              引言:XRP钱包的必要性

              在数字货币逐渐走入大众视野的今天,XRP作为瑞波币的一种代表性数字资产,也同样吸引了大量关注。为什么开发XRP钱包变得如此重要?首先,数字货币的安全性和可用性是投资者最关心的问题。适合的XRP钱包不仅能够安全存储您的资产,且在交易时提供方便的体验。本文将深入探讨XRP钱包开发的过程、注意事项以及安全性等关键因素。

              XRP钱包的基础知识

              XRP钱包开发:如何打造安全又易用的数字钱包?

              在解释钱包开发之前,我们需要了解什么是数字钱包。数字钱包是用来存储、发送和接收数字资产的工具,可以是软件、硬件或者网页应用。具体到XRP钱包,它支持瑞波币的存储和交易,提供个人用户或企业用户不同的使用体验。

              选择XRP钱包的类型

              在开发XRP钱包之前,首先需要确定想要构建的钱包类型。通常,数字钱包可以分为以下几类:

              • 热钱包:在线钱包,方便随时访问,非常适合频繁交易。
              • 冷钱包:离线存储,安全性更高,适合长时间持有资产的用户。
              • 移动钱包:手机应用,使用便捷,适合随时随地进行小额交易。
              • 桌面钱包:适合在个人电脑上使用,通常具备丰富的功能与设置。
              • 硬件钱包:物理设备,能提供最高级别的安全性,适合大额持币用户。

              开发者必须根据目标用户的需求,决定最适合的类型。

              XRP钱包开发的关键步骤

              XRP钱包开发:如何打造安全又易用的数字钱包?

              1. 技术选型

              选择适合的开发框架和语言是成功的第一步。例如,可以使用JavaScript、Python、Ruby等语言进行开发。同时,使用如React、Node.js、Django等框架能够加速开发进程。

              2. 配置XRP API

              与XRP网络交互需要使用相关的API,了解如何连接到XRP Ledger至关重要。通过Ripple提供的API,开发者可以轻松地构建交易、查询余额等功能。

              3. 用户身份验证

              安全性是钱包开发的重中之重,为了防止未授权访问,你需要实现安全的用户身份验证方法,例如OAuth、JWT等技术。此外,额外的双重验证也能够大幅提高安全性。

              4. 数据加密

              确保用户数据和交易信息的加密存储,不仅保护用户隐私,也防止黑客攻击。可以使用AES、RSA等加密算法。

              5. 用户界面设计

              用户体验(UX)是钱包成功的关键,确保界面简洁易用,无障碍的交互设计能够大幅提高用户留存率。清晰的指引、友好的设计能够帮助用户轻松上手。

              XRP钱包的安全性挑战

              在发展XRP钱包的过程中,必须时刻考虑安全挑战,包括但不限于:

              • 黑客攻击:安全漏洞可能使钱包被黑客攻陷,盗取用户资金。
              • 社会工程学攻击:用户可能被诈骗者利用社交工程手段欺骗,进而泄露敏感信息。
              • 合约漏洞:智能合约的设计不当,可能导致意外损失。

              因此,在设计开发流程中,进行全面的测试和漏洞扫描是必要的。同时,定期更新是保持安全的关键。

              潜在的问题与解答

              如何确保用户的资金安全?

              确保用户资金安全的最佳实践包括:

              • 提供多种安全选项:例如,采用多重签名技术,要求多方确认交易才能成功。
              • 提示用户风险:定期教育用户如何防范诈骗、保护私钥,确保他们了解安全使用钱包的重要性。
              • 紧急应对机制:实施事务监控和警报系统,以便及时发现异常活动并做出响应。

              如何提高用户体验?

              提升用户体验的策略包括:

              • 简化开户流程:减少不必要的步骤,提升用户的操作流畅度。
              • 提供实时客服支持:在任何遗漏或疑问时,能及时为用户解决问题,增强信任感。
              • 定期更新与反馈机制:根据用户反馈持续改进,为用户提供新的功能与服务,保持钱包的竞争力。

              总结

              XRP钱包的开发是一个复杂而具有挑战性的过程,需要从技术选型到用户体验全面考虑。一方面,我们必须注重钱包的功能与安全性;另一方面,提升用户体验也至关重要。最后,通过持续的维护与更新,XRP钱包可以不断适应市场变化,为用户提供良好的服务。希望本文章能为想要开发XRP钱包的开发者提供一些启示和帮助,让你的产品能够在竞争激烈的市场中脱颖而出。

              分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        2023年最受欢迎的NEAR钱包推
                                        2025-02-17
                                        2023年最受欢迎的NEAR钱包推

                                        随着区块链技术的迅速发展,越来越多的用户开始探索加密货币的世界,而NEAR协议凭借其快速、低费用和易于使用的...

                                        如何将USDT从钱包转账到交
                                        2025-01-24
                                        如何将USDT从钱包转账到交

                                        在当今的数字货币世界中,USDT(泰达币)因其与美元1:1的锚定关系而成为广泛使用的稳定币。许多投资者和交易者在...

                                        以太坊钱包的选择:如何
                                        2025-04-02
                                        以太坊钱包的选择:如何

                                        以太坊(Ethereum)作为一种领先的区块链平台,凭借其智能合约功能、去中心化应用程序(DApps)等特性,吸引了众多...

                                        区块链系统到底由哪些关
                                        2025-09-03
                                        区块链系统到底由哪些关

                                        引言 随着数字时代的飞速发展,区块链技术逐渐成为各个领域关注的焦点。从金融和供应链到医疗和物联网,区块链...